summaryrefslogtreecommitdiffstats
path: root/core/modules/kexec-reboot
diff options
context:
space:
mode:
authorSimon Rettberg2018-03-24 15:44:31 +0100
committerSimon Rettberg2018-03-24 15:44:31 +0100
commitb6436b781dba9383ef938cc7fb17532a12373a93 (patch)
tree0764941bd2c938a7138adbecaee85b5dd11395c8 /core/modules/kexec-reboot
parent[rfs-stage32] Smarter handling of ID45; unify part detection; sort by size (diff)
downloadmltk-b6436b781dba9383ef938cc7fb17532a12373a93.tar.gz
mltk-b6436b781dba9383ef938cc7fb17532a12373a93.tar.xz
mltk-b6436b781dba9383ef938cc7fb17532a12373a93.zip
[kexec-reboot] Fix dependency ordering
Finish shutdown before triggering the final kexec reboot
Diffstat (limited to 'core/modules/kexec-reboot')
-rw-r--r--core/modules/kexec-reboot/data/etc/systemd/system/kexec.service3
1 files changed, 1 insertions, 2 deletions
diff --git a/core/modules/kexec-reboot/data/etc/systemd/system/kexec.service b/core/modules/kexec-reboot/data/etc/systemd/system/kexec.service
index 45c117ad..6c33a6bc 100644
--- a/core/modules/kexec-reboot/data/etc/systemd/system/kexec.service
+++ b/core/modules/kexec-reboot/data/etc/systemd/system/kexec.service
@@ -3,9 +3,8 @@ Description=Reboot via kexec
Documentation=man:kexec(8)
DefaultDependencies=no
Wants=kexec-load.service
-After=kexec-load.service
Requires=shutdown.target final.target
-Before=shutdown.target final.target
+After=kexec-load.service shutdown.target final.target
[Service]
Type=oneshot